net effect

简明释义

净效应

英英释义

The overall result or outcome after all factors have been considered, often used to describe the final impact of a situation or action.

在考虑所有因素后得出的整体结果或影响,通常用于描述某种情况或行动的最终影响。

In recent years, the debate surrounding climate change has intensified, prompting individuals, businesses, and governments to evaluate their roles in contributing to environmental sustainability. One crucial aspect of this discussion is understanding the net effect of various actions and policies on our planet. The term net effect refers to the overall impact of a series of actions after considering all positive and negative outcomes. This concept is particularly important when assessing the efficacy of environmental initiatives.For instance, when a city implements a new public transportation system, the initial investment may seem exorbitant. However, if we analyze the net effect of this system, we must consider factors such as reduced traffic congestion, lower greenhouse gas emissions, and improved air quality. These benefits can lead to a healthier population and potentially lower healthcare costs over time. Therefore, while the upfront costs are significant, the net effect could be overwhelmingly positive.Similarly, companies are increasingly adopting sustainable practices to reduce their environmental footprint. By switching to renewable energy sources or implementing waste reduction strategies, they not only contribute to a cleaner environment but also often find that these practices lead to cost savings in the long run. The net effect of such changes can result in enhanced brand reputation, customer loyalty, and even increased profitability. Thus, it becomes evident that the short-term sacrifices made for sustainability can yield substantial long-term benefits.Moreover, individual actions also play a vital role in determining the net effect on the environment. Simple choices, such as using reusable bags, reducing water consumption, or choosing local products, collectively contribute to a more sustainable future. Each person's efforts may seem insignificant, but when multiplied across millions of individuals, the net effect can be transformative. This illustrates the power of collective action and how individual decisions can lead to significant environmental impacts.In conclusion, understanding the net effect of our actions is essential in addressing the pressing challenges of climate change and environmental degradation. By evaluating both the positive and negative outcomes of initiatives, we can make informed decisions that promote sustainability. Whether at the level of government policy, corporate strategy, or personal behavior, recognizing the net effect allows us to appreciate the broader implications of our choices and encourages a more responsible approach to our planet's future. As we move forward, it is imperative that we continue to assess and optimize the net effect of our actions to ensure a healthier environment for generations to come.
